Which car brand features a galloping horse logo?

1 Answers
Desiree
07/29/25 9:24pm
The car brand featuring a galloping horse logo is the Ford Mustang. The side profile of the car includes a C-shaped opening, tri-bar taillights, and a galloping horse emblem positioned in the center of the grille. Additional information: The name "Mustang" was first used on the Mustang I sports concept car introduced in 1962. At that time, the logo was designed by Phil Clark, depicting a galloping wild horse. After the production Mustang model was launched in 1964, the galloping horse logo also underwent changes, and this evolution has continued to the present day. The Ford Mustang logo (MUSTANG) features a galloping wild horse, symbolizing the car's exceptional speed. The Mustang is a prized wild horse native to California and Mexico, and using it as the emblem represents a spirit of youthful exuberance and unrestrained freedom, making the car an enduringly popular American sports car.

Where is the keyhole for the Audi A4?

Audi A4 does not have a keyhole; it is equipped with a one-button start system. Introduction to one-button start: The one-button start device is part of a smart car, a button device that simplifies the starting process and can also turn off the engine. This device can be retrofitted in the original key lock position or installed as an independent panel. Functions of one-button start: Unlike traditional mechanical key ignition methods and conventional starting procedures, simply pressing the one-button start button can start or turn off the engine, eliminating the hassle of losing or searching for keys. During the ignition process, most require pressing the foot brake.

What are the reasons why the car always has no power and cannot start?

Under normal circumstances, a vehicle can be parked for up to one week. If the car frequently has no power and cannot start, the primary task is to check whether there is an issue with the battery quality or if its performance has degraded, necessitating the replacement of a new battery. Secondly, the vehicle may have an electrical leak, requiring the identification of the leaking component and checking if additional electrical devices have been installed. Methods for maintaining a car battery: 1. Avoid long-term parking in open parking lots: If parking for an extended period, the battery should be removed and taken away to prevent freezing damage. 2. Pay attention to the starting time: The car engine is harder to start in winter. Each attempt to start the car should not exceed 5 seconds, with a minimum interval of 15 seconds between attempts. If the car still does not start after several attempts, check other aspects such as the circuit, ignition coil, or fuel system. Avoid multiple uninterrupted attempts to start, as this can cause the battery to over-discharge and burn out. 3. Regularly charge the car battery: A battery left unused for a long time will gradually self-discharge until it becomes unusable. Therefore, the car should be started periodically to charge the battery. 4. Clean the terminals regularly: The battery terminals should be cleaned periodically and coated with special grease to protect the wiring harness. Regularly inspect the battery accessories and connecting lines. 5. Avoid using car electrical appliances after the engine is turned off: Using the battery alone when the engine is not generating power can cause damage to it.

How to Park on a Slope Without Rolling Back?

When parking on a slope, pay attention to the coordination of the throttle, clutch, and handbrake: engage first gear and slowly release the clutch while lightly pressing the throttle pedal. When the car's clutch reaches the semi-engaged state, quickly release the handbrake, then gently press the throttle pedal while releasing the clutch pedal. Below is additional information about electronic parking brakes: 1. Electronic Brake: This refers to a technology that integrates the temporary braking function during driving with the long-term parking brake function, achieved through electronic control. 2. Electronic Parking Brake: This technology uses electronic control to achieve parking braking. Its working principle is the same as that of a mechanical handbrake, both relying on the friction generated between the brake disc and brake pads to control parking braking. The only difference is that the control method has changed from the previous mechanical handbrake lever to an electronic button.

What are the functions of couplings and clutches? What are the differences between them?

Here is the relevant introduction about the functions and differences between couplings and clutches: 1. Function of couplings: Used to connect two shafts together. During machine operation, the two shafts cannot be separated. Only when the machine is stopped and the connection is disassembled can the two shafts be separated. 2. Function of clutches: Used to connect two shafts together, allowing the two shafts to be separated or engaged during machine operation. 3. Differences: Couplings connect two half-shafts together to enable effective power transmission. They cannot be disengaged during operation. Clutches are a special method of power transmission, requiring the ability to disengage or engage at any time during operation, hence the name clutch. Couplings only have the function of connecting and transmitting power, while clutches not only have the function of connecting and transmitting power but also the functions of deceleration and reversing.

What Causes the Timing Chain Stretching Failure in the Enclave?

The reasons for timing chain stretching causing failure in the Enclave: Wear on the sprockets and chain rollers leads to geometric dimension changes, resulting in timing errors, and the engine malfunction indicator light will illuminate. Function of the Timing Chain: The primary significance of the timing chain lies in transmitting power from the crankshaft to drive the engine's valve train, ensuring that the engine's pistons can properly complete the four strokes of intake, combustion, power, and exhaust, thereby maintaining normal engine operation. Structure of the Timing Chain: The entire system consists of components such as gears, chains, and tensioning devices. Among them, the hydraulic tensioner can automatically adjust the tension force, keeping the chain tension consistent. This not only enhances safety and reliability but also significantly reduces the engine's usage and maintenance costs, achieving multiple benefits with a single solution.
